Nikerabbit has uploaded a new change for review.

  https://gerrit.wikimedia.org/r/261327

Change subject: codesniffer to 0.5.1, grunt-jsonlint to 1.0.7
......................................................................

codesniffer to 0.5.1, grunt-jsonlint to 1.0.7

Change-Id: I010e63d84702d30adb51b5c019b85efe8ae9c08a
---
M composer.json
M ffs/MediaWikiComplexMessages.php
M package.json
M scripts/translator-stats-process.php
M specials/SpecialSupportedLanguages.php
M tests/phpunit/HookDocTest.php
6 files changed, 18 insertions(+), 7 deletions(-)


  git pull ssh://gerrit.wikimedia.org:29418/mediawiki/extensions/Translate 
refs/changes/27/261327/1

diff --git a/composer.json b/composer.json
index e2ee904..8be462f 100644
--- a/composer.json
+++ b/composer.json
@@ -40,7 +40,7 @@
        },
        "require-dev": {
                "jakub-onderka/php-parallel-lint": "0.9",
-               "mediawiki/mediawiki-codesniffer": "0.4.0"
+               "mediawiki/mediawiki-codesniffer": "0.5.1"
        },
        "suggest": {
                "mediawiki/babel": "Users can easily indicate their language 
proficiency on their user page",
diff --git a/ffs/MediaWikiComplexMessages.php b/ffs/MediaWikiComplexMessages.php
index cd03e2f..2be2a19 100644
--- a/ffs/MediaWikiComplexMessages.php
+++ b/ffs/MediaWikiComplexMessages.php
@@ -77,10 +77,11 @@
                                continue;
                        }
 
-                       foreach ( $values as $index => $value )
+                       foreach ( $values as $index => $value ) {
                                if ( in_array( $value, $defs[$item], true ) ) {
                                        unset( $current[$item][$index] );
                                }
+                       }
                }
 
                return $current;
@@ -471,7 +472,9 @@
                $text = '';
                $errors = array();
                $this->validate( $errors, $filter );
-               foreach ( $errors as $_ ) $text .= "#!!# $_\n";
+               foreach ( $errors as $_ ) {
+                       $text .= "#!!# $_\n";
+               }
 
                foreach ( $this->getGroups() as $group => $data ) {
                        if ( $filter !== false && !in_array( $group, 
(array)$filter, true ) ) {
diff --git a/package.json b/package.json
index aa347fe..7b70396 100644
--- a/package.json
+++ b/package.json
@@ -8,6 +8,6 @@
     "grunt-cli": "0.1.13",
     "grunt-contrib-jshint": "0.11.3",
     "grunt-jscs": "2.5.0",
-    "grunt-jsonlint": "1.0.6"
+    "grunt-jsonlint": "1.0.7"
   }
 }
diff --git a/scripts/translator-stats-process.php 
b/scripts/translator-stats-process.php
index 042039f..df6497d 100644
--- a/scripts/translator-stats-process.php
+++ b/scripts/translator-stats-process.php
@@ -47,7 +47,12 @@
                fgets( $handle );
 
                $data = array();
-               while ( ( $l = fgets( $handle ) ) !== false ) {
+               while ( true ) {
+                       $l = fgets( $handle );
+                       if ( $l === false ) {
+                               break;
+                       }
+
                        $fields = explode( "\t", trim( $l, "\n" ) );
                        list( $name, $reg, $edits, $translator, $promoted, 
$method ) = $fields;
                        $month = substr( $reg, 0, 4 ) . '-' . substr( $reg, 4, 
2 ) . '-01';
diff --git a/specials/SpecialSupportedLanguages.php 
b/specials/SpecialSupportedLanguages.php
index c05f4af..6da2c8f 100644
--- a/specials/SpecialSupportedLanguages.php
+++ b/specials/SpecialSupportedLanguages.php
@@ -420,8 +420,9 @@
                $keys = array_keys( $list );
                shuffle( $keys );
                $random = array();
-               foreach ( $keys as $key )
+               foreach ( $keys as $key ) {
                        $random[$key] = $list[$key];
+               }
 
                return $random;
        }
diff --git a/tests/phpunit/HookDocTest.php b/tests/phpunit/HookDocTest.php
index f6bc77c..2a343ae 100644
--- a/tests/phpunit/HookDocTest.php
+++ b/tests/phpunit/HookDocTest.php
@@ -98,10 +98,12 @@
                $hooks = array();
                $dh = opendir( $path );
                if ( $dh ) {
-                       while ( ( $file = readdir( $dh ) ) !== false ) {
+                       $file = readdir( $dh );
+                       while ( $file !== false ) {
                                if ( filetype( $path . $file ) == 'file' ) {
                                        $hooks = array_merge( $hooks, 
call_user_func( $callback, $path . $file ) );
                                }
+                               $file = readdir( $dh );
                        }
                        closedir( $dh );
                }

-- 
To view, visit https://gerrit.wikimedia.org/r/261327
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: I010e63d84702d30adb51b5c019b85efe8ae9c08a
Gerrit-PatchSet: 1
Gerrit-Project: mediawiki/extensions/Translate
Gerrit-Branch: master
Gerrit-Owner: Nikerabbit <[email protected]>

_______________________________________________
MediaWiki-commits m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to